Perfecting Precision Aluminium Cuts: Miter Saw Techniques
To obtain flawless aluminium cuts with your miter box , using precise technique is truly crucial. Begin with selecting the correct blade – a fine-tooth blade designed for non-ferrous metals including aluminium will reduce tearing and friction. Regularly clamp your aluminium workpiece securely to prevent wobble during the division process. Moreover , evaluate making a test cut on a waste piece to fine-tune your angle settings. Ultimately, let the blade to execute the work; don't strain it through the material, as this can lead to a uneven edge or even blade kickback .
- Pick the right saw tooth.
- Clamp the workpiece tightly.
- Preview your settings .
- Prevent pushing the blade .
